2003-01-27: Piper PA-60-601P (N3636Q) — Duane E. Shrontz — Scottsdale, AZ

Scottsdale, AZ, US

On January 27, 2003, a Piper PA-60-601P (registration N3636Q) operated by Duane E. Shrontz was involved in an aviation accident near Scottsdale, AZ. Investigators recorded the probable cause as: the pilot's failure to maintain an adequate altitude clearance from mountainous terrain. Contributing factors were dark night conditions, mountainous terrain, and the pilot's diverted attention. An airplane collided with mountainous terrain five miles from the departure airport during a dark night takeoff. Radar data showed a transponder code change and a climb to 3,500 feet before impact.

Accident Overview

The airplane struck mountainous terrain five miles from the departure airport during a dark night takeoff. The accident site elevation was 3,710 feet, located 0.1 miles from the last radar target return.

Radar Data

Review of recorded radar data revealed a secondary beacon code 7267 on the runway at 2021:08, with a mode C report consistent with the airport elevation. Two additional secondary beacon returns were noted on or over the runway at 2021:12 and 2021:19, reporting mode C altitudes of 1,600 and 1,700 feet, respectively. Between 2021:08 and 2021:38, the target proceeded on a northeasterly heading of 035 degrees (runway heading), as the mode C reported altitude climbed to 2,000 feet and the computed ground speed increased to 120 knots. Between 2021:38 and 2021:52, the heading changed from an average of 035 to 055 degrees, while the mode C reports continued to climb at a mathematically derived rate of 1,300 feet per minute and the ground speed increased to an average of 170 knots.

At 2022:23, the code 7267 target disappeared and was replaced by a 1200 code target. The mode C reports continued to climb at a mathematically derived rate of 1,200 feet per minute as the ground speed increased to the 180-knot average range. The computed average heading of 055 degrees was maintained until the last target return at 2022:53, which showed a mode C reported altitude of 3,500 feet. The direct point-to-point magnetic course between Scottsdale and Santa Fe was found to be 055 degrees.

Witness Observations

Numerous ground witnesses living at the base of the mountain where the accident occurred reported hearing the airplane and observing the aircraft's lights. The witnesses reported observations consistent with the airplane beginning a right turn when a large fireball erupted coincident with the airplane's collision with the mountain.

Wreckage Examination

No preimpact mechanical malfunctions or failures were found during an examination of the wreckage. The radar data establishes that the pilot changed the transponder code from his arrival IFR assignment to the VFR code 30 seconds before impact and this may have been a distraction.
